Дана последовательность натуральных чисел. Расстояние между элементами последовательности — это разность их порядковых номеров. Например, если два элемента стоят в последовательности рядом, расстояние между ними равно 1, если два элемента стоят через один — расстояние равно 2 и так далее. Назовём парой любые два числа из последовательности. Необходимо определить количество пар, в которых сумма элементов и расстояние между ними имеют равные остатки от деления на 9.
Первая строка входного файла содержит целое число N общее количество чисел в наборе. Каждая из следующих N строк содержит одно число, не превышающее 109.
Вам даны два входных файла (A и B), каждый из которых имеет описанную выше структуру. В ответе укажите два числа: сначала искомое количество пар для файла A, затем — последние 6 цифр искомого количества пар для файла B.
Ответ:
Решение. Приведем решение на языке Python для файла A.